Israel killed Hezbollah missile commander Ibraham al-Kubaisi in an airstrike on the southern Beirut suburb of Dahiya on Tuesday, in an attack that was apparently confirmed by Lebanese sources. Reuters reported: An Israeli airstrike on the southern suburbs of Beirut on Tuesday killed a Hezbollah commander who was a leading figure in its rocket division, two security sources in Lebanon said, as fears of a full-fledged war in the Middle East mounted.
